1. Online Selling Through Marketplaces
You don’t need to be a business expert to start selling online.
- Where to start: Amazon, Flipkart, Meesho, or Etsy (for handmade products).
- What to sell: Fashion accessories, home décor, stationery, or even reselling items.
- Why it works: Platforms handle payments, delivery, and logistics.
👉 Example: Many homemakers in India earn ₹10,000–₹50,000 per month by simply reselling products through Meesho without any prior business experience.
2. Content Writing and Blogging
If you can write simple, clear sentences, you can earn.
- Work type: Blog posts, product descriptions, website content, social media captions.
- Platforms: Fiverr, Upwork, Freelancer, or directly pitching to companies.
- Growth path: Start small, then move to your own blog for passive income through ads or affiliate marketing.
👉 Example: A college student writing blogs at ₹500 per article can gradually scale to ₹20,000+ per month as experience grows.
3. Online Tutoring
Teaching doesn’t always need formal degrees. If you know basic English, Math, or even hobbies like dance, cooking, or crafts—you can teach online.
- Platforms: Vedantu, Chegg, Teachmint, UrbanPro.
- Subjects: School-level academics, spoken English, music, yoga, etc.
- Earning: ₹300–₹1,000 per session depending on subject and demand.
4. Social Media Management
Small businesses need help managing Facebook, Instagram, or WhatsApp promotions. If you understand hashtags, trends, and posting styles, you can start managing accounts.
- Tasks: Creating posts, replying to comments, scheduling updates.
- Tools to learn: Canva (for designs), Buffer (for scheduling).
- Earning potential: ₹5,000–₹25,000 per client monthly.
👉 Many youngsters now earn more from social media management than traditional jobs.
5. Data Entry & Virtual Assistance
This requires no prior experience and only basic computer knowledge.
- Tasks: Data entry, Excel work, email handling, scheduling calls.
- Platforms: Fiverr, PeoplePerHour, Clickworker.
- Earning potential: ₹10,000–₹20,000 monthly part-time.
6. Selling Homemade Food or Tiffin Services
Food is always in demand, and homemade meals are loved by working professionals and students.
- How to start: Begin from your kitchen and deliver locally.
- Tools: Swiggy, Zomato, or even WhatsApp groups.
- Growth path: Expand into catering or packaged snacks business.
👉 Example: Many women in Tier-2 Indian cities have built successful tiffin businesses starting from just 5–10 daily orders.
7. Print-on-Demand Business
No need to hold stock—design products online, and platforms print and ship them for you.
- Products: T-shirts, mugs, phone cases, tote bags.
- Platforms: Printrove, Teespring, Redbubble.
- Skills needed: Simple designing on Canva.
8. Freelance Voiceover or Translation
If you speak clearly or know multiple languages, opportunities are endless.
- Work type: Audiobooks, YouTube videos, advertisements, subtitles.
- Platforms: Voices.com, Upwork, Freelancer.
- Earning: ₹500–₹5,000 per project depending on language.
9. Affiliate Marketing
Recommend products and earn commission when people buy through your link.
- Platforms: Amazon Associates, Flipkart Affiliate, Awin.
- Method: Promote products via WhatsApp groups, social media, or blogs.
- Passive income: Once content is set, earnings continue without daily effort.
10. Online Surveys & Micro-Tasks
Not a full-time income but great for extra cash.
- Websites: Swagbucks, ySense, Toluna.
- Tasks: Surveys, app testing, feedback.
- Earning potential: ₹2,000–₹7,000 monthly in spare time.
11. Graphic Designing with Free Tools
Even without professional training, tools like Canva and Crello make design easy.
- Projects: Social media posts, flyers, business cards.
- Platforms: Fiverr, Freelancer, Instagram promotions.
- Earning: ₹5,000–₹30,000 monthly depending on clients.
12. Pet Sitting or Online Services
Pet care is in demand in urban India.
- Work type: Walking pets, feeding, or offering online consultations (like pet diet plans).
- Platforms: Local classifieds, Facebook groups.
- Why it works: Minimal investment, purely trust-based service.
13. YouTube or Podcasting
Content creation is booming. With just a smartphone and internet, you can start.
- Content ideas: Tutorials, comedy, cooking, lifestyle, local stories.
- Earnings: Ads, sponsorships, affiliate promotions.
- Growth tip: Consistency matters more than quality in the beginning.
14. Handmade Crafts & DIY Products
If you enjoy creativity, this is a great option.
- Products: Jewelry, candles, soaps, crochet items.
- Platforms: Etsy, Instagram, local exhibitions.
- Earning: ₹2,000–₹50,000 depending on effort and reach.
15. Dropshipping Business
Sell products online without storing inventory.
- Process: Customer orders → You forward order to supplier → Supplier ships directly.
- Tools: Shopify, WooCommerce.
- Why easy: No stock management, minimal investment.

FAQs on Side Hustles Without Experience
- Can I start a side hustle with zero investment?
Yes, options like content writing, tutoring, or affiliate marketing require no upfront money. - How much can I realistically earn per month?
Beginners can earn ₹5,000–₹20,000; with consistency, this can scale to ₹50,000+. - Do side hustles require quitting my main job?
Not at all—most can be done part-time in evenings or weekends. - Are these opportunities safe?
Stick to verified platforms (Amazon, Fiverr, Vedantu, etc.) and avoid scams promising “quick money.” - Which side hustle grows fastest?
Social media management, online tutoring, and freelancing usually show results within 1–2 months.
